What to check before for buildings with low open violation rates in Queens

  • Expect buildings with fewer open violations indicate better overall maintenance.
  • Confirm safety and conditions by reviewing tenant feedback on specific buildings.
  • Check for lease terms that might require you to ask about any remaining violations.
  • Consider building-sponsored amenities and rules that may come alongside compliance measures.
  • Visit buildings in person to assess the condition and feel of the environment.
